These types of alarms are allowed to get executed even in low power modes. setExactAndAllowWhileIdle – This method came up with Android M.setExact – Setting an alarm manager using this ensures that the OS triggers the alarm at almost the exact time.setInExactAndRepeating – This doesn’t trigger the alarm at the exact time.There are different types of Alarm Manager that can be invoked: tInexactRepeating(AlarmManager.RTC_WAKEUP, System.currentTimeMillis(), interval, pendingIntent) PendingIntent pendingIntent = PendingIntent.getBroadcast(context, 0, alarmIntent, 0) ![]() Intent alarmIntent = new Intent(context, MyAlarmReceiver.class) Then pass the PendingIntent which would get executed at a future time that you specify.ĪlarmManager manager = (AlarmManager) getSystemService(Context.ALARM_SERVICE) To start an Alarm Manager you need to first get the instance from the System.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|